A Memory of Thornton Heath.

My family lived in Osborne Road so my brothers and I went to Beulah Infant and Junior Schools. I think Mrs Colby was head of Infznts and Mrs Grumberg head of Juniors. Mrs Bird was my favourite teacher. I loved having stories outside in the garden in the summer. There was a swing and a large fallen tree that we could play on. My friends were Jenny Gray and Catherine Holloway. Jenny lived in Livingstone Road (I think) and Catherine in Osborne Gardens. I also remember Carolyn Moffat; Carol Milne, Beverly ?, Jeffrey? Sharon Jewson, Jane Worral, another Carol, Peter Morgan ( who’s dad taught my mum to drive)
I remember the rag and bone man coming round with his horse and cart. The Mooney family from over the road. And the excitement of being sent across the road to buy milk from the dairy. Anybody recall any of this?
